#6 processclock.h uses memset in header file but does not #include <string.h>

processclock.h uses memset in header file but does not #include if processclock.h is included before string.h compilation will fail

https://gogs.reru.org/GfA/libgfaservices/src/master/common/processclock.h#L112

in most cases string.h is already included earlier in projects therefore the compiler will not raise an error.

WORKING

#include <string.h>
#include "gfa/svc/common/processclock.h"

NOT WORKING

#include "gfa/svc/common/processclock.h"
#include <string.h>

/opt/GfA/TC_L44104_C493_QT57_V02/usr/arm-buildroot-linux-gnueabihf/sysroot/usr/include/gfa/svc/common/processclock.h:112: error: ‘memset’ was not declared in this scope
memset(&m_sc[nClockIndex].tsStopclock, 0, sizeof(struct timespec));
                                                                 ^
